Course Basics: Course number, name, instructor contact info, meeting times/locations, and a brief course description. Learning Objectives: State what students will know or be able to do by the end, both overall and (if possible) for each unit or module.

Course syllabus refers to a part of a professors pedagogy and passion for their discipline. It provides students with a comprehensive description of the courses goals and objectives, assessment techniques and learning outcomes. It is important that a syllabus communicates all aspects of a course to students.

A course description provides an overview of what a course covers, while a syllabus provides specific details about the course, such as the schedule, grading criteria, assignments, textbook requirements, and policies.
